A Brief Guide to Data Warehousing and Business Intelligence

Overview As more and more data is being created and converted to digital streams, businesses need a way to consolidate and harness all of it. That's where a data warehouse comes in. Once they've got all of that data connected, they need a way to tap into it for powerful reporting and forecasting. That what business intelligence is for, as this TechRepublic Webcast explains. The topics covered include:

  • Understanding why and when you need a data warehouse
  • Making the case to the business for a data warehouse project
  • Understanding and communicating the value of business intelligence (BI)
  • Using BI for nimble decision-making
